The Royal Fleet Auxiliary ship “Mounts Bay” moored at Greenwich Ship Tier Buoys, Greenwich, Greater London on the occasion of the Platinum Jubilee of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II. She is a Bay-Class auxiliary landing ship dock, named after Mounts Bay in Cornwall. She provides logistical support to the Royal Navy and facilitates amphibious operations by offloading troops when required.
